How to hire a tree removal & trimming pro in Philippines
- A DENR permit is legally required to cut trees in the Philippines — even on private land for most species; barangay/LGU endorsement is part of the process
- For coconut palms, a separate PCA (Philippine Coconut Authority) permit is required before cutting
- Use experienced crews with rigging for trees near houses and power lines
- Coordinate with the utility for line-adjacent trees
- Agree debris disposal and whether wood stays with you
- Get the total price in writing before work starts
Tree cutting in the Philippines generally requires DENR permits even on private land, and coconut palms need Philippine Coconut Authority permits under the Coconut Preservation Act. Typhoon-damaged tree clearance is a major seasonal demand driver.

Frequently asked questions
What is the difference between tree trimming, pruning and lopping?
Pruning is selective, health-focused cutting done to standards; trimming usually means clearance and shaping. 'Lopping' — indiscriminate topping of the crown — damages trees, triggers weak regrowth, and is explicitly discouraged in arborist standards. If a quote says 'top it', find another contractor.
When is the best time of year for tree work?
Dormant-season (late winter) pruning suits most deciduous species, and arborists' schedules are quieter then. Legal timing matters too: many countries restrict work during bird-nesting season, and some species (oaks, elms) have disease-driven no-prune windows. Emergency safety work happens whenever needed.
Does home insurance cover tree removal?
Typically only when a tree falls and damages insured property or blocks access — then removal of the fallen tree is covered as part of the claim. Pre-emptive removal of a healthy or even dying tree is rarely covered, though a documented arborist report of hazard can sometimes help.
How much does tree removal cost?
Price scales with height, trunk diameter, condition and — above all — access and what the tree can fall on. A small open-lawn tree is a morning's work; a large tree over a house, pool or power lines needs rigging or a crane and costs many times more. Stump grinding is almost always quoted separately.
Do I need permission to remove a tree on my own property?
Very often yes — councils and municipalities widely protect trees by size, species or zone, and fines for unpermitted removal are severe. Check before quoting: a legitimate tree company will know local permit rules and often handles the application for you. Never trust 'don't worry about the permit'.
Do I really need a permit to cut a tree on my own lot in the Philippines?
Yes in most cases — DENR tree-cutting permits apply to private land, with barangay endorsement in the paperwork, and coconuts additionally need PCA permits. Legit contractors know the process; illegal cutting fines (and even imprisonment provisions) target the owner too.
